This PR tightens how the Bramblekit component library publishes versions. As a new contractor, note that we previously allowed pre-release tags to flow into production manifests, which caused the Orlin dashboard regression last quarter. This change adds a verification step in the release pipeline that checks semver compatibility before publishing and blocks mismatched peer dependencies. Please review the pipeline script carefully. The tuning constants governing the checks follow below.

tuning table, fawep-fajof:
QUOTAS = {
    "druael": 2,
    "holwyn": 5,
    "ulaix": 2,
    "druix": 2,
}

## Account Recovery — Trailnote Offline Mode

When a surveyor's Trailnote app has been offline for 30+ days, their local credentials expire and sync refuses to resume. Don't make them wipe the device — all their unsynced field data lives there! Instead, open the support console, pick "Offline Reinstate," and enter their handle. The console will ask for the support team's shared recovery passphrase before issuing a reinstatement token. Use the one below.

unlock words, bagaf-fajeg: zorael-kelax-fraath-quenix-eliok-sileth-aldmir-wenir-druiel

Q: Why does the Haulbird driver-assignment heuristic sometimes pick a farther driver?

A: The heuristic scores candidates on distance, current load, and acceptance history, not distance alone. A nearby driver with two pending pickups can score worse than a farther idle one. This is intentional and reduces late deliveries overall. If you see assignments that look wrong, capture the request ID and check the scoring breakdown. The full weighting table and tuning history are on the internal page below.

dashboard of tawef-hagug = https://superset.norvadyn.local/display/projects/build/ticket/build/spaces/ticket/1e989f0e6c200d20fc4ae06b

### v3.2.0 — Renamed setting

Keyspindle no longer reads `KS_ROTATE_TOKEN`; it was renamed for consistency with the plugin API. Plugins targeting 3.2+ must use the new name or rotation hooks will not fire. The old name is ignored silently — no deprecation warning is emitted. Update your `.env` before upgrading. Keep `KS_PLUGIN_DIR` and `KS_LOG_LEVEL` as-is. Immediately after those entries, add the renamed token line with your existing value.

secret setting of kawif-kajef: COURIER_KEY3=d2b